I have pgAdmin III v. 1.2.0. beta installed on Windows XP SP1.
I downloaded the pgadmin3-1_2_0-beta1.zip file and installed the
pgadmin3.msi.

When I attempt to backup a database, I get an error saying that the
"MSVCR71.dll" is missing and that I should try to re-install the program.

I have re-installed the program but the file is still missing. I did a
search on my machine and found two other instances of that file (Yahoo
messenger, and Dreamweaver MX 2004), so I copied it to the pgAdmin III
directory and tried again.

This time I got an error saying that libssl32.dll was missing. I searched
for that file, but could not find it.

Any ideas as to what I may be doing wrong?
